创建你的DEV博客的静态镜像

创建你的DEV博客的静态镜像

💡 原文英文,约400词,阅读约需2分钟。
📝

内容提要

作者发现DEV链接在多个平台被“影子禁用”,决定将文章发布到自己域名上。通过Perl脚本生成静态文章和索引页,避免了前端开发的麻烦。与ChatGPT互动后,快速实现并优化了功能,用户只需修改用户名和博客名即可生成静态网站,并可通过定时任务更新新文章。

🎯

关键要点

  • 作者在使用DEV平台时发现其链接在多个主要平台上被影子禁用,导致内容无法有效分享。
  • 为了解决这个问题,作者决定将DEV文章发布到自己的域名上,以便自由分享。
  • 作者使用Perl脚本生成静态文章和索引页,避免了前端开发的麻烦。
  • 通过与ChatGPT互动,作者快速实现并优化了功能,用户只需修改用户名和博客名即可生成静态网站。
  • 生成的静态网站可以通过定时任务更新新文章,提升了内容更新的效率。

延伸问答

为什么作者决定将DEV文章发布到自己的域名上?

因为DEV链接在多个主要平台上被影子禁用,导致内容无法有效分享。

作者使用了什么工具来生成静态文章?

作者使用了Perl脚本来生成静态文章和索引页。

如何使用作者提供的Perl脚本生成静态网站?

用户只需修改脚本中的用户名和博客名,然后运行脚本即可生成静态网站。

生成的静态网站如何保持内容更新?

可以通过定时任务(cron)来更新网站的新文章。

作者在实现过程中遇到了什么挑战?

作者不喜欢前端开发,因此希望避免使用前端框架,选择了简单的Perl脚本。

与ChatGPT的互动对作者的项目有什么帮助?

通过与ChatGPT互动,作者快速实现并优化了功能,减少了查阅文档的时间。

➡️

继续阅读